Transaction 331a0b02e991de857175bdf58f3570efc685318e95e84ef21b6f976e38582972
1 Input
1 Output
-
331a0b02e991de857175bdf58f3570efc685318e95e84ef21b6f976e38582972:0
- value
- 108794
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22e8ce4acc34edee84c75ce9be0c0d322f22c5c6 OP_EQUAL
- address
- 34sbnhUBduqYLdZeS7YuSjVG6MnuVnB641